Peperoni e Tonno (Tuna-Stuffed Pepper Rolls)

Elegant Italian-inspired tuna salad nestled in roasted red pepper strips and rolled into tender bundles. This simple yet refined dish combines briny capers, fresh herbs, and creamy mayonnaise with premium albacore tuna, finished with a drizzle of extra-virgin olive oil and fresh parsley. Perfect as a light main course or sophisticated appetizer.

Ingredients

One 6-ounce can high-quality albacore tuna in water, drained

3 tablespoons Mayonnaise

2 tablespoons Celery, finely chopped

2 teaspoons Fresh lemon juice

1½ teaspoons Capers, drained and roughly chopped

½ teaspoon Fresh oregano leaves

Salt

Freshly ground black pepper

6 Jarred roasted red peppers, drained

Extra-virgin olive oil

Fresh flat-leaf parsley, finely chopped

Freshly cracked black pepper for garnish

Directions

  1. In a medium bowl, flake the drained tuna with a fork until it reaches your desired texture—fine and spreadable or with some larger pieces, based on preference.

  2. Add the mayonnaise, chopped celery, lemon juice, capers, fresh oregano, salt, and freshly ground pepper to the tuna. Stir gently until all ingredients are evenly combined.

  3. Lay one roasted red pepper flat on a clean work surface. Spoon approximately 2 tablespoons of the tuna mixture onto the pepper, positioning it about 1 inch from one edge.

  4. Roll the pepper tightly around the filling, starting from the filled edge and rolling toward the opposite end. The pepper should form a secure cylinder. Repeat with the remaining peppers and filling.

  5. Arrange the pepper rolls on a serving platter seam-side down. Drizzle lightly with extra-virgin olive oil and garnish with finely chopped fresh parsley and a crack of black pepper.

  6. Serve immediately at room temperature, or chill for up to 4 hours before serving for a cooler presentation.
